Known as "Sugar Shane" Mosley, this American former professional boxer has left an indelible mark on the sport, holding multiple world championships in three weight classes. With a career spanning over two decades, Mosley's impressive record and numerous accolades have cemented his position as one of the greatest boxers of all time.
Born on September 7, 1971, in Lynwood, California, Mosley grew up in Pomona, California, with two older sisters, Venus and Cerena. His fascination with boxing began when he watched his father, Jack, engage in street fights. Under his father's guidance, Mosley started training at the age of eight, paving the way for his successful amateur and professional career.

With an impressive amateur record of 250-16, Mosley was poised for a successful professional career.
Mosley made his professional debut on February 11, 1993, defeating Greg Puente via knockout in the fifth round. He went on to win his next six fights in 1993, all inside the distance. In 1994, he fought nine times, winning all of them, with eight victories coming by way of knockout.
